Effective Solution of Certain Boundary Value Problems for Prismatic Variable Thickness Shells (Effektivnoe Reshenie Nekotorykh Granichnikh Zadach dlya Prizmaticheskikh Obolochek Peremennoi Tolshchiny),

Abstract

Equilibrium equations for shells, in contrast to classical equations, are fully compatible with physical boundary conditions. This paper considers the case where the pattern of the stress and deformation condition of the shell is subject to very insignificant change along the normal of the mean height. This case, called by I. N. Vekua an approximation of the order N=O, and representing a momentless theory, is supplemented in such a manner that the corresponding system of shell equations is common with three physical boundary conditions. (Author)
